Release checklist — GridForge crossword generator, item 7. Before sign-off, double-check that the dictionary bundle hasn't picked up any user-submitted wordlists; those skip the profanity filter and we've been burned before. Also confirm the puzzle export endpoint still strips author metadata. Nothing fancy, just eyeball the diff and the bundle manifest. Once you're happy, record your approval against the build token below.

pipeline stamp: htk9_ce63042d9

**Handover note — Basement Archive Room**

For whoever takes over records duty: the archive room is at the bottom of the back stairs in Pellard House, past the boiler room. Boxes are shelved by year, then department — the index binder is on the trolley by the door. Keep the dehumidifier running and log anything you remove in the sign-out sheet. The light switch is behind the door, not beside it. The keypad on the archive door takes this code:

badge for hahip-bagag: bdg-FIJ-9

# Burrowmill Build Environments

Burrowmill's render service is mid-migration to the Stonecask hermetic build system. Dev and staging already build hermetically; prod still uses the legacy toolchain until the vendored assets are checked in. Reviewers: reject changes that fetch at build time — everything must resolve from the lockfile. Staging is the canonical reference environment during the migration. Its build workers boot with the configuration below.

service settings:
PRAIX_LOG_LEVEL=error
PRAIX_METRICS_HOST=metrics.praix.qorvelcorp.corp
PRAIX_POOL_SIZE=16

All Ledgermere report exports are generated in UTC and converted to the tenant's configured timezone at render time. If a tenant reports off-by-one-day totals, check their timezone setting before touching the export job — daylight-saving transitions account for nearly all such tickets. Do not modify timestamps in the warehouse; the raw data is correct. To reproduce an export, run the `exportctl replay` tool against the staging renderer with the tenant ID and date range. The replay tool authenticates to the renderer with the key below.

gateway credential: zpat23_7qqcGYpjzOqgK8YXbFMnj5A